前端开发负责构建用户直接交互的界面层,涵盖浏览器端Web应用和桌面端跨平台应用。现代前端已从简单的页面展示演变为复杂的单页应用架构,涉及组件化开发、状态管理、构建优化、服务端渲染等工程化实践。前端技术栈更新迭代快,框架和工具链的选择直接影响开发效率、用户体验和应用性能。
Pinia如何实现跨组件的状态共享与通信
本文详细介绍了Pinia如何实现跨组件的状态共享与通信,包括创建Store、在组件中使用Store、跨组件共享状态和通信的方法,以及应用场景、技术优缺点和注意事项等。CSS伪元素高级用法:解决内容装饰与布局的特殊需求
本文详细介绍了CSS伪元素的高级用法,包括解决内容装饰与布局的特殊需求。通过丰富的示例,如自定义引号、段落首字特效、清除浮动等,让读者了解如何运用伪元素提升网页的美观和实用性。同时,分析了应用场景、技术优缺点和注意事项,帮助不同基础的开发者掌握这一技术。JavaScript函数式编程的核心概念与应用场景
本文详细介绍了函数式编程的核心概念,包括纯函数、高阶函数、闭包和柯里化等,结合具体的 JavaScript 示例进行说明。同时阐述了函数式编程在数据处理、异步编程和事件处理等方面的应用场景,分析了其技术优缺点和注意事项。帮助不同基础的开发者理解函数式编程的原理和应用,提升编程能力。解决HTML元素默认样式的不一致性:运用CSS Reset与Normalize.css标准化基础样式
在网页开发中,HTML元素默认样式不一致是常见问题。本文介绍了使用CSS Reset和Normalize.css解决该问题的方法。详细讲解了CSS Reset和Normalize.css的概念、使用示例、优缺点及注意事项,并分析了它们的应用场景。CSS Reset可将所有元素默认样式重置,而Normalize.css能让默认样式更一致且保留有用样式。小型项目适合用CSS Reset,大型项目建议用Normalize.css。前端状态管理新宠Zustand,如何应对高并发场景?
介绍前端状态管理库Zustand在高并发场景下的应用、优势、注意事项等,通过详细示例说明其使用方法,帮助开发者更好地应对高并发场景下的状态管理问题。解决Electron应用打包后资源路径引用错误导致的静态文件加载失败
本文详细介绍了Electron应用打包后资源路径引用错误导致静态文件加载失败的问题。首先分析了问题的背景和常见的应用场景,如前端页面引用静态资源和主进程加载静态资源。接着探讨了常见的错误原因,包括相对路径问题和打包工具配置问题。然后给出了具体的解决办法,如使用__dirname和path模块、配置打包工具以及使用process.resourcesPath。同时,还分析了各种解决办法的优缺点和注意事项。最后对文章进行了总结,帮助开发者解决Electron应用打包后的资源加载问题。Svelte的动画效果实现:技巧与性能优化
本文详细介绍了Svelte动画效果的实现技巧与性能优化方法。从基本的淡入淡出、缩放、滑动动画,到高级的自定义动画和动画组合,都有详细示例。还探讨了Svelte动画的应用场景、技术优缺点和注意事项。能帮助开发者更好地使用Svelte实现动画效果,提升网页用户体验。Angular编译器优化选项深度解析:如何通过调整构建配置减少最终打包体积?
深入解析 Angular 编译器优化选项,介绍如何通过调整构建配置减少最终打包体积,包括启用 AOT 编译、优化资源加载、代码分割等方法,分析各方法的应用场景、优缺点及注意事项。在Angular中使用TypeScript的实战经验分享
本文分享了在 Angular 中使用 TypeScript 的实战经验,包括基础回顾、在 Angular 中的具体使用、应用场景、优缺点及注意事项等,帮助开发者更好地掌握这一技术组合。Bootstrap与前端框架(如Vue、React)的组件集成模式与最佳实践
本文详细介绍了 Bootstrap 与前端框架(如 Vue、React)的组件集成模式与最佳实践。首先对前端框架和 Bootstrap 进行了简介,接着阐述了直接引入、自定义组件封装和混合使用等集成模式,还给出了按需引入、样式覆盖等最佳实践。同时分析了应用场景、技术优缺点和注意事项,最后进行了总结,帮助开发者更好地掌握两者的集成方法。深入解析Bootstrap响应式栅格系统在复杂布局场景下的适配方案与常见陷阱
本文深入解析了Bootstrap响应式栅格系统在复杂布局场景下的适配方案与常见陷阱。介绍了响应式栅格系统基础,包括其概念和Bootstrap的特点。详细阐述了多列布局和嵌套布局的适配方案,并给出了具体示例。分析了常见陷阱如列宽总和超过12、忽略屏幕尺寸断点等及解决办法。还探讨了应用场景、技术优缺点和注意事项,最后进行了总结,帮助开发者更好地使用Bootstrap栅格系统。Rollup打包ESM格式代码时的配置要点及注意事项
本文详细介绍了Rollup打包ESM格式代码时的配置要点、应用场景、优缺点、注意事项等,帮助开发者更好地使用Rollup进行代码打包。CSS容器查询的原理与应用
本文详细介绍了 CSS 容器查询的原理与应用。先解释了容器查询的概念,通过示例展示了如何定义容器和设置查询条件。接着列举了响应式卡片布局和自适应导航菜单等应用场景,分析了容器查询的优缺点,包括更灵活的布局和浏览器兼容性问题等。还提到了使用时的注意事项,如浏览器兼容性、性能问题和命名规范。最后总结了容器查询的重要性和应用前景,帮助开发者更好地理解和运用这一特性。解决HTML中iframe跨域通信难题:利用postMessage实现安全高效的数据传递
本文介绍了HTML中iframe跨域通信难题以及利用postMessage实现安全高效数据传递的方法。详细阐述了postMessage的原理、语法,通过电商支付和新闻评论等应用场景进行示例演示,分析了该技术的优缺点和使用注意事项,帮助开发者解决跨域通信难题。Angular代码分割技术:按需加载提升应用性能的实践
本文详细介绍了 Angular 代码分割技术,包括其实现方式、应用场景、优缺点、注意事项等,通过大量示例帮助开发者理解如何通过按需加载提升应用性能。CSS布局中浮动的原理与使用场景
本文详细介绍了CSS布局中浮动的原理与使用场景。首先阐述了浮动的基本原理,包括其作用机制和对文档流的影响。接着列举了浮动在多列布局、图文混排、导航栏布局等方面的使用场景,并给出了详细的示例。还分析了浮动的优缺点,以及使用浮动时的注意事项,如清除浮动、注意元素宽度等。最后对文章进行了总结,帮助读者全面了解浮动技术。探索 jQuery 在跨浏览器兼容性中的历史贡献与现代应对策略
本文详细探讨了 jQuery 在跨浏览器兼容性方面的历史贡献,介绍了其如何简化 DOM 操作、统一事件处理和动画效果。同时,给出了现代应对跨浏览器兼容性问题的策略,包括结合现代 JavaScript 特性、使用框架和库的组合等。还分析了 jQuery 的应用场景、优缺点和注意事项,帮助开发者更好地使用 jQuery 解决跨浏览器兼容性问题。Vue过渡动画实现技巧:让页面交互更流畅
本文介绍了 Vue 过渡动画的实现技巧,包括基础示例、应用场景、优缺点及注意事项等,帮助开发者让页面交互更流畅。Bootstrap过渡动画优化:解决页面切换卡顿的性能调优
本文主要介绍了在网页开发中使用 Bootstrap 时过渡动画卡顿的问题及优化方法。详细阐述了应用场景,如电商网站、企业官网和博客网站等,分析了技术的优缺点,常见卡顿原因,如动画复杂度高、页面元素过多等。给出了具体的优化方法,包括减少动画复杂度、优化页面元素、利用硬件加速和优化 CSS 选择器等,还强调了注意事项,最后总结了优化的要点,帮助开发者提升页面过渡动画的流畅度。
第 1 / 126 页